I am not sure that it is a pin that is the problem. I have the Viper 550 and when my hood pin was acting up I would always get a second chirp when setting my alarm. When you set it you should only get 1 chirp. If you get a second then it means that one of the sensors is tripped. That should be how you would know if it is a sensor or not.
